  • Abstract
    This paper examines the application of an Ideal Rotating Transformer (IRTF) model for evaluating the transient and steady state behaviour of a self-excited induction generator. The IRTF model is outlined and compared with the traditionally used dq induction machine model. Simulated results from both models are compared to experimental results obtained from a 4kW induction machine. The merits of each approach are considered.
